Brian Pearlstein practices family law at Brodsky Renehan Pearlstein & Bouquet in Gaithersburg, Maryland. He is the managing partner at the firm, which focuses on divorce and related family law matters. The firm is known for its comprehensive approach to family disputes. This gives personalized legal strategies tailored to their unique situations. His experience spans several years, and he is known for handling complex divorce cases in the District of Columbia. He earned his Bachelor of Arts degree in Political Science from the University of Michigan - Ann Arbor in 1984.
